create database PEPUSTAKAAN
Use PERPUSTAKAAN
create table TBLPINJAM(nomor int Primary Key, nama varchar(25),
jurusan varchar(4), BukuPinjaman varchar(30))
insert into TBLPINJAM values(1,'Chyntia','TI1A','Strukdat')
insert into TBLPINJAM values(2,'Chyntia2','SI2B','Oracle')
insert into TBLPINJAM values(3,'Chyntia3','MI23','Mat Stastistik')
insert into TBLPINJAM values(4,'Chyntia4','SA4A','Aljabar')
insert into TBLPINJAM values(5,'Chyntia5','TK21','Bisnis')
insert into TBLPINJAM values(6,'Chyntia6','SA31','Management')
insert into TBLPINJAM values(7,'Chyntia7','KA42','Sistem Komputerisasi')
insert into TBLPINJAM values(8,'Chyntia8','SA4A','B. Inggris')
insert into TBLPINJAM values(9,'Chyntia9','MI23','B. Indonesia')
select * from TBLPINJAM
Fungsi-Funsi AGREGAT
GAMBAR :
SELECT AVG(NOMOR) as "Nilai Rata-rata" FROM TBLPINJAM
GAMBAR :
SELECT MAX(NOMOR) as "Nilai Tertinggi" FROM TBLPINJAM
GAMBAR :
SELECT MIN(NOMOR) as "Nilai Terendah" FROM TBLPINJAM
GAMBAR :
SELECT SUM(NOMOR) as "Nilai Total" FROM TBLPINJAM
GAMBAR :
SELECT COUNT(NOMOR) as "Nilai Banyak Data" FROM TBLPINJAM
gambar :
--Menampilkan Banyak Data sesuai Kelompok (group ,contoh : Jurusan)
SELECT jurusan, COUNT(jurusan) as Kelas FROM TBLPINJAM
GROUP BY jurusan
GAMBAR :
/* COMPUTE -> Untuk membuat subtotal, berdasarkan jurusan dan diurutkan secara ASCENDING*/
SELECT NOMOR,NAMA, jurusan FROM TBLPINJAM
ORDER BY jurusan
COMPUTE COUNT(jurusan) BY jurusan
GAMBAR :
lATIHAN :
1.MENAMBAHKAN KOLOM LAMA (INT) PADA TABEL ANDA
JAWAB :
ALTER TABLE TBLPINJAM ADD LAMA INT
2. Isikan sesuai dengan karakter ke 3 jurusan
Update TBLPINJAM Set Lama=SUBSTRING(jurusan,3,1)
select Jurusan,Lama From TBLPINJAM
--HAVING --> menentukan batasan kondisi hasil proses.
--Mencari Lama pinjam yang lebih dari 2 hari
SELECT jurusan, SUM(Lama) As[yg Lebih Dari 2 Hari] FROM TBLPINJAM
GROUP BY jurusan
HAVING SUM(Lama) > 2
Rabu, 16 November 2011
Rabu, 02 November 2011
LATIHAN 10
/*Latihan
A. Tampilkan nama peminjam dan jurusan yan namaya berakhiran 2 dan 4
B. Tampilkan nama peminjam yang jurusannya berawalan T dan yang
meminjam buku bewalan B*/
JAWABAN A :
select nama as [Nama Peminjam],Jurusan from TBLPINJAM
where nama like '%2' or nama like '%4'
GAMBAR / HASIL
JAWABAN B :
select nama as [Nama Peminjam] from TBLPINJAM
where jurusan like 'T%' And BukuPinjaman like 'B%'
GAMBAR / HASIL
/* Latihan C
Tambahkan Field Lama Pinjam Tipe Interger
(isikan Data Lama, Anda sesuaikan Sendiri)*/
JAWABAN C :
Alter Table TBLPINJAM add Lama int
Update TBLPINJAM set Lama=2 Where nomor='1'
---Atau :
Update TBLPINJAM set lama=2 where LEFT(jurusan,1)='T'
Update TBLPINJAM set Lama=4 where LEFT(jurusan,1)='S'
update TBLPINJAM set Lama=3 where LEFT(jurusan,1)='M' OR left(jurusan,1)='K'
GAMBAR / HASIL
A. Tampilkan nama peminjam dan jurusan yan namaya berakhiran 2 dan 4
B. Tampilkan nama peminjam yang jurusannya berawalan T dan yang
meminjam buku bewalan B*/
JAWABAN A :
select nama as [Nama Peminjam],Jurusan from TBLPINJAM
where nama like '%2' or nama like '%4'
GAMBAR / HASIL
JAWABAN B :
select nama as [Nama Peminjam] from TBLPINJAM
where jurusan like 'T%' And BukuPinjaman like 'B%'
GAMBAR / HASIL
/* Latihan C
Tambahkan Field Lama Pinjam Tipe Interger
(isikan Data Lama, Anda sesuaikan Sendiri)*/
JAWABAN C :
Alter Table TBLPINJAM add Lama int
Update TBLPINJAM set Lama=2 Where nomor='1'
---Atau :
Update TBLPINJAM set lama=2 where LEFT(jurusan,1)='T'
Update TBLPINJAM set Lama=4 where LEFT(jurusan,1)='S'
update TBLPINJAM set Lama=3 where LEFT(jurusan,1)='M' OR left(jurusan,1)='K'
GAMBAR / HASIL
PERTEMUAN 10
RUMUS :
create database PEPUSTAKAAN
Use PERPUSTAKAAN
create table TBLPINJAM(nomor int Primary Key, nama varchar(25),
jurusan varchar(4), BukuPinjaman varchar(30))
insert into TBLPINJAM values(1,'Chyntia','TI1A','Strukdat')
insert into TBLPINJAM values(2,'Chyntia2','SI2B','Oracle')
insert into TBLPINJAM values(3,'Chyntia3','MI23','Mat Stastistik')
insert into TBLPINJAM values(4,'Chyntia4','SA4A','Aljabar')
insert into TBLPINJAM values(5,'Chyntia5','TK21','Bisnis')
insert into TBLPINJAM values(6,'Chyntia6','SA31','Management')
insert into TBLPINJAM values(7,'Chyntia7','KA42','Sistem Komputerisasi')
select * from TBLPINJAM
GAMBAR / HASIL
RUMUS 2 :
--Mencari & Menampilkan Buku pinjaman Ber-Awalan S
select * from TBLPINJAM where BukuPinjaman like 'S%'
--Mencari & Menampilkan Buku Pinjaman Ber-Akhiran T
select * from TBLPINJAM where BukuPinjaman like '%t'
--Mencari & Menampilkan Jurusan yang terdapat huruf i
select * from TBLPINJAM where jurusan like '%i%'
--Mencari & Menampilkan jurusan yang ber-Awalan S dan Ber-Akhiran 1
select * from TBLPINJAM where jurusan like 'S%1'
GAMBAR / HASIL
create database PEPUSTAKAAN
Use PERPUSTAKAAN
create table TBLPINJAM(nomor int Primary Key, nama varchar(25),
jurusan varchar(4), BukuPinjaman varchar(30))
insert into TBLPINJAM values(1,'Chyntia','TI1A','Strukdat')
insert into TBLPINJAM values(2,'Chyntia2','SI2B','Oracle')
insert into TBLPINJAM values(3,'Chyntia3','MI23','Mat Stastistik')
insert into TBLPINJAM values(4,'Chyntia4','SA4A','Aljabar')
insert into TBLPINJAM values(5,'Chyntia5','TK21','Bisnis')
insert into TBLPINJAM values(6,'Chyntia6','SA31','Management')
insert into TBLPINJAM values(7,'Chyntia7','KA42','Sistem Komputerisasi')
select * from TBLPINJAM
GAMBAR / HASIL
RUMUS 2 :
--Mencari & Menampilkan Buku pinjaman Ber-Awalan S
select * from TBLPINJAM where BukuPinjaman like 'S%'
--Mencari & Menampilkan Buku Pinjaman Ber-Akhiran T
select * from TBLPINJAM where BukuPinjaman like '%t'
--Mencari & Menampilkan Jurusan yang terdapat huruf i
select * from TBLPINJAM where jurusan like '%i%'
--Mencari & Menampilkan jurusan yang ber-Awalan S dan Ber-Akhiran 1
select * from TBLPINJAM where jurusan like 'S%1'
GAMBAR / HASIL
Langganan:
Postingan (Atom)











